PLANS EXAMINER REVIEW COMMENTS
1. Engineer has calculated the wind loading to 140 MPH / Risk CAT 1 * This facility falls into
the 145 MPH mark line / Exposure C / Please correct the wind load sheets and the foundation
design calculations.
RESPONSE: Please see revised wind load sheets and foundation design calculations.
2. Engineer to design the required grounding between the foundation steel and the vertical structure
on plans.
RESPONSE: Please see revised plans.
3. Need the foundation risk letter submitted, signed by the contractor.
RESPONSE: Please see the foundation risk letter.
